| 释义 | sum·mons    (sŭmənz)n. pl.   sum·mons·es  1.  A call by an authority to appear, come, or do something. 2.  Law   a.  An order or process directing a person, especially a defendant in a case, to appear in court. b.  An order or process directing a person to report to court as a potential juror. tr.v.  sum·monsed, sum·mons·ing, sum·mons·es   Law 1.  To order to appear in or report to court by means of a summons: the defendant was summonsed to the district court. 2.  To serve with a summons.  [Middle English somons, from Old French somonse, from feminine past participle of somondre, to summon; see  SUMMON.]  |
